Looking at changing things up this year from the typical beach thing and taking a vacation somewhere that we have not been. I have some interests in visiting Lake Martin (or somewhere similar) but I know nothing about the area. I am mainly wanting to rent a house for my family for roughly a week and bring my boat. Question, is there nice places to pull the boat up and let the family swim or is it all anchoring in deep water?

I live a mile or so from Martin and frequently go to fish or lounge on the water. There are quite a few places to beach your boat on the lower end of the lake. There were no trespassing signs posted on the Russell Lands owned property on the lake to discourage social gathering due to covid 19, not sure if they are still enforcing this. Lake rentals are pretty pricey, can go for beach vacation for the same dollars, have looked into this for a staycation. Lake is stupid busy this year so be prepared for rough water around boat traffic if your boat is on the smaller side. It's a big lake so you can get away from the crowds if you want to. Wind creek, Blue creek, Kowaliga, chimney rock will be your busiest areas.

We always take the kids to the landing at Parker creek during the day. Great beach and activities. Usually chucks or coppers in still water for dinner. Coppers you park at the marina and catch a golf cart to the restaurant. Chimney rock is fun to watch, and so is goat landing but the will both be mad houses. North Beach can get crowded at times but it’s one of the biggest cleanest beaches on the lake. You should be able to find plenty of sloughs or islands that have smaller beaches where you can get a little privacy as well.

I grew up on Lake Martin and as others have said, it has changed dramatically in the last 10 years. For most of life, it never seemed crowded unless you were at Chimney Rock and folks understood the rules of operating a boat. It was common for a wave or a drink salute when you passed another boater. That's done with now. With the infiltration of folks from Atlanta and the overall lack of courtesy, it can be a rough place on the weekend. Sunday afternoon until Saturday AM are pretty good times to be on the lake most of the year. I usually hit the water with the family until about 10:00 and let all the folks head to the rock and then get back on the water after they've gone.

This past Saturday there were more boats on the water than I have ever seen other than at the fireworks show on the July 4th. Watched some Idot come through Peanut Point (no wake zone) in a fully loaded pontoon boat with the throttle down. Tons of boats and people in the water. Amazed he didn't kill or injure a bunch of people. Get ready, plans are in place for a large development and a mid-lake connector to 280 that will make getting to the lake from Atlanta easier.
